Our programs in Business Administration provide an enterprise wide view of advanced skills in business and management disciplines, including practical experience in the application of those skills in the context of the overall dynamics of organizations. The hallmarks of our business program are an emphasis on students learning in a diverse community of international and multicultural learners, while preparing to contribute to significant business issues in a socially engaged manner.  

Our students are prepared for professional practice and responsible leadership in corporations, governmental and non-governmental organizations in the national and international arena. Our Professional Development program has been recently strengthened to allow students to gain practical experience in business practices, as well as in community, environmental and ethical practices. In addition to the content knowledge gained in the courses, students get trained for professional practice through a three-part training which includes traditional internship, professional identity coaching, and community service learning projects. This is geared towards supporting them for competing in the contemporary job market.

The business stakeholders, including our faculty, students and alumni, are working together to set the learning goals for our programs. Our business students will have:

1. Professional skills for communication in writing and in presentation

2. Skills in critical thinking in the context of business management

3. A positive, pro-active and non-judgmental attitude towards diverse cultural and international identities and in their interpersonal and professional interactions

4. An understanding and the ability for ethical decision making in business scenarios

5. The skills to work well in international, multicultural teams

6. Knowledge in the selected business and management concentration (for MBA and BS) or specialization (for DBA) of study

All programs are:

  • International and multi-cultural - to provide the understanding and skills that are required for success in a multicultural global environment

  • Multidisciplinary - to provide a view of the organization that includes critical skills from Business and Management, Global Studies and Organizational Psychology

  • Environment-driven - to provide the understanding and analytic skills that are necessary to evaluate and respond appropriately to an organization’s changing economic, political, cultural and technological environments with special emphasis on sustainable and social engagement

  • Experiential for Professional Practice - to provide practical experience working with multicultural teams on practical and significant problems in corporate, governmental and non-governmental organizations in the national and international arenas.

  • Change-oriented - to provide the attitude, understanding and skills necessary to achieve success in turbulent organizational environments

  • Holistic - to provide an overall perspective of the organization as a system
